@Tyme3 жыл бұрын
This method is for 8 bit photos. When using 16 bit photos you want to set the blending mode to "add", the offset to 0, and check the invert box.

@BLTV_Photoshop5 жыл бұрын
This works on CC 2018, as well. Use "Select and Mask" instead of "Refine Edge" or Shift-click "Select and Mask" to open "Refine Edge".
